Dharamshala, July 19 -- Chief minister (CM)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u on Sunday invited investors to invest in Himachal Pradesh, describing the state as one of the most suitable destinations for investment.

Sukhu said that Himachal Pradesh ensures round-the-clock power supply and was introducing a new industrial policy with reduced electricity tariffs to attract greater investment.

Addressing the Chandigarh Leadership Conclave and the 23rd Annual General Meeting organised by TiE (The Indus Entrepreneurs Chandigarh) on Saturday late evening, the chief minister said that the state government was committed to provide every possible facility and support to investors.
